Event Description

The New Haven Preservation Trust welcomes special guest lecturer, Sean Khorsandi, Co-Director of the Paul Rudolph Foundation.

Paul Rudolph arrived in New Haven with great promise and left New Haven with seven significant, realized works. From his designs for our city government to campus interventions and meeting the needs of New Haven’s mid-century housing crisis, Rudolph’s eclectic style developed and matured through his time here and ultimately defined his work that followed.
